    Rising competitiveness of the Presidents Cup

    Though the U.S. has dominated the Presidents Cup, profitable 12 of the 14 occasions, the worldwide crew has began to slender the hole lately.

    Since its inception, the worldwide crew, composed of prime gamers from outdoors Europe and America, has struggled to safe a win, with their solely victory coming in 1998, and a tie in 2003.

    Whereas the competitors has typically been overshadowed by the extra emotionally charged Ryder Cup, latest Presidents Cups have delivered nearer outcomes.

    In 2015, the People narrowly beat the worldwide crew 15.5-14.5 in South Korea, and in 2019, the U.S. once more eked out a victory, 16-14, in Australia.

    This yr, the competitors strikes to The Royal Montreal Golf Membership, giving the worldwide squad a possible house benefit with three Canadian gamers: Corey Conners, Mackenzie Hughes, and Taylor Pendrith, on the roster.
